@MCarter - I am sorry for your frustration. As suggested above, try emailing the social team to see if they can help. Based on your being new to the forums, it seems like this may be your first or one of your first big-ticket purchases at QVC. If that is the case, as a standard practice, additional verification steps are often required to ensure that the transaction will be completed, especially if you choose Easy Pay.

 

One other thing to keep in mind is that customer service staffing is often lower on the weekends than during the week, so perhaps you'll have better luck calling if you try again tomorrow. I hope everything works out for you!

 

 

P.S. The charge you see for the first payment will not actually be formally assessed against your card/account until your item is shipped. It is a hold that applies to all QVC customers, old and new, while an order is being prepared. So if something doesn't work out and your item does not actually ship, that hold should disappear within 48-72 hours, based on your bank or card provider.
